The Jammu and Kashmir government on Wednesday made wearing face masks mandatory in all public places including colleges, schools, multiplexes, hotels, banks, and markets. The decision came after a recent spike in COVID-19 cases in the Jammu district.

The public circular released by the office of the Deputy Commissioner, Jammu mentioned that β€œVarious preventive measures have been recommended by the Ministry of Health and Family Welfare, Government of India which include wearing of face masks, maintenance of social distance and hand hygiene etc”. The official notice also mentioned ensuring the implementation and observance of all preventive measures such as usage of face masks, and maintenance of social distance in all the public places across the district to curb the spread of COVID-19 infections
